We have here a thick cased Rolex Master II 16710A with "SWISS" only dial and the desirable "lug holes" from U serial. The SWISS/lug holes combination only overlapped for a fairly short period of time (1999/2000) with some degree of rarity. The case is THICK, lugs are very symmetrical with square crown guards that engulf the crown. Lug holes are also nice and deep and preferred by many collectors.
